In a quirky blend of reality and fiction, the film explores the absurdity of commercialization in Malaysian culture. The story follows a struggling filmmaker who faces numerous challenges in creating meaningful art while navigating a world dominated by consumerism. As he encounters eccentric characters and unexpected situations, the film reflects on the impact of commercialization on creativity and personal integrity. Through humor and satire, it offers a critique of societal values and the tension between artistic passion and financial survival, ultimately questioning what it means to sell out in a rapidly changing world.
